A digital (finger) rectal examination checks for problems in organs
or other structures in the pelvis and lower abdomen. During a digital rectal
examination, your doctor puts a lubricated, gloved finger of one hand into the
rectum and may use the other hand to press on the lower abdomen or pelvic
area.
